// Gradle如果想要使用Lombok,不能像Maven一样直接导入Lombok的jar就行
compileOnly group: 'org.projectlombok', name: 'lombok', version: '1.18.22'
// 想要使用Lombok,还需要使用导入注解处理器(在Maven中是默认会导入这个依赖的)
annotationProcessor group: 'org.projectlombok', name: 'lombok', version: '1.18.22'
// 如果只导入上述的依赖,@Data等注解已经可以正常使用了,但是想要使用@Slf4j去很方便地打印日志却并不行
// 会报错无法找到程序包`lombok.extern.slf4j`不存在,但是打开外部库一看该包是存在的
// 那么很可能就是slf4j相关的支持的jar包没导入进来导致该组件不能使用,因此需要导入下面这些相关的依赖
implementation group: 'org.slf4j', name: 'slf4j-api', version: '1.7.32'
testImplementation group: 'org.slf4j', name: 'slf4j-log4j12', version: '1.7.32'
testImplementation group: 'org.slf4j', name: 'slf4j-simple', version: '1.7.32'